Danny Eugene Esslinger v. Leoneal Davis, Warden Attorney General of the State of Alabama

Citations

  • 44 F.3d 1515
  • 1995 U.S. App. LEXIS 1234
  • 1995 WL 21589

How courts have described this case

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.

  • holding that the lower court’s sua sponte invocation of procedural default served no important federal interest under the circumstances
  • “We do not hold that an attorney who recommends a blind plea inherently fails to perform as required by the Sixth Amendment.”
  • “The state can waive a procedural bar to relief by explicitly waiving, or by merely failing to assert, the bar in its answer to the habeas petition.”
